Here is another question for the libpd4unity crew:

What is the right approach for mixing audio generated by PD, with audio
generated by Unity?
It seems that my "AudioListener" component attached to my "LibPd" game
object is preventing any other Unity AudioSources to play sound.

Any experience with this?

>> Android latency is often a fact of life, even by that much. one question
>> is whether you're getting that latency playing it in the Editor. if not,
>> that may be a libpd question that would need answering. you might also
>> reach out to Sebastian(hagish) to ask him, though he might be no longer
>> working with libpd since Kalmiba wasn't updated in a while. he did in fact
>> say that Android latency was an issue in the Read Me. however you might
>> have more luck with this fork which has a latency fix in Android. not sure
>> how good it is, but it's been updated about a year ago:
>>
>> https://github.com/marcinkaszynski/kalimba
